RCF L 12P530
Thiele-Small parameters
| Nominal size | 12" |
|---|---|
| Impedance | 8 Ω |
| Fs | 56 Hz |
| Qts | 0.269 |
| Qes | 0.29 |
| Qms | 3.7 |
| Vas | 59 L |
| Sd | 530 cm² |
| Xmax | 3.7 mm |
| Re | 4.7 Ω |
| Bl | 17.5 T·m |
| Mms | 53.9 g |
| Pe | 300 W |
| Sensitivity | 99.8 dB |
Alignment hint
| EBP | 193 · ported |
|---|---|
| Sealed Vb (Qtc ≈ 0.71) | ≈ 10 L |
EBP > 100: favours a ported (bass-reflex) alignment.
Rules of thumb from T/S parameters only. Verify against a real simulation before cutting wood.
